Output 75cc4f609b5acfaf0e893eade86baa5d64330c6c2d908b22f044405fa878cac2:12

value
28728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7b806ac7669ffed0fc83e5be800f430272ec96 OP_EQUAL
address
3McFBQXUFb5KiSwnQFaNbWYoCLnssxw4J5
transaction
75cc4f609b5acfaf0e893eade86baa5d64330c6c2d908b22f044405fa878cac2
confirmations
118259
spent
true